The Alluring Benefits of Owning a Bengal Cat

Bengal cats are a truly unique breed, and there are numerous advantages to having one as a pet. Their wild appearance, engaging personality, enthusiastic nature, and robust physique have made them incredibly popular. The Bengal cat, with its distinct traits, has consistently ranked among the most sought-after domestic cat breeds in recent years. They have truly captured the hearts of many potential cat owners.

1. Wild Appearance

The Bengal cat is a medium to large-sized breed, boasting a slender body and well-defined muscles. Their prominent nose, wide, almost circular eyes, and slightly smaller head give them a strikingly feral look. With their spotted coat and lithe figure, the Bengal cat exudes a unique wild beauty, resembling a miniature leopard. This distinct aesthetic ensures that owning a Bengal cat will turn heads, making any owner feel incredibly proud.

2. Engaging Personality

While many cats are considered cute, they often lack a truly engaging personality. Bengal cats, however, possess a dynamic spirit inherited from their wild ancestors. This legacy has endowed them with exceptional intelligence and emotional sensitivity, setting them apart from other breeds. Owning a Bengal cat will reveal a companion that enthusiastically greets you at the door, lounges on your lap, or quietly sits beside you at the table. They understand your words, follow your commands, and always remain close by when needed. They are truly remarkable and a faithful pet companion.

3. Enthusiastic Nature

One of the most delightful aspects of owning a Bengal cat is the joy of taking your "little wildcat" for a walk, which is sure to draw admiring glances. While many cats are known for their timidity, the Bengal cat’s intelligence and zeal for exploration make them eager to explore unfamiliar environments. With a bit of training and guidance, they can be taken on walks and even swimming adventures, behaving much like a canine companion. This adventurous spirit is something that appeals to many potential Bengal cat owners.

4. Robust Physique

Many hereditary diseases in cats arise from a limited gene pool, a classic example being the Scottish Fold. Bengal cats, however, have the broadest gene pool of all cat breeds, protecting them from a number of genetic predispositions. These unique traits set Bengals apart from other cat breeds, making them a highly desirable pet. Their good health and unique characteristics contribute to their ranking as a top pet choice.
